How to Stay Updated with the Latest Trends in Computer Engineering
Computer engineering is a rapidly evolving field, where new technologies, tools, and innovations are constantly shaping the future. To remain competitive and relevant in this dynamic industry, it's essential for students, professionals, and enthusiasts to stay up-to-date with the latest trends. Here are some practical ways to keep yourself informed and ahead in the world of computer engineering.

1. Follow Reputed Tech News Platforms
Start by subscribing to well-known tech news websites. Such platforms regularly publish articles, updates, and insights about the latest developments in electronic computer engineering and related fields.
2. Take Online Courses and Webinars
Platforms like Coursera, edX, Udemy, and LinkedIn Learning offer specialized courses on emerging computer engineering topics. Webinars hosted by universities and tech companies can also be a great source of real-time information and interactive learning.
3. Join Industry Forums and Online Communities
Participate in communities such as Stack Overflow, Reddit (like r/computing or r/engineering), and GitHub. These platforms allow you to engage in discussions, share knowledge, and learn from others in the field.
4. Attend Conferences and Workshops
Events like CES, DEF CON, and ACM/IEEE conferences bring together professionals, researchers, and students from across the globe. Attending these events, even virtually, can provide you with fresh perspectives and expose you to cutting-edge research.
5. Read Research Journals and Technical Magazines
Journals published by IEEE, ACM, and Springer cover the latest research in computer and electronic engineering. Staying informed through these publications can deepen your understanding and inspire innovative thinking.
6. Follow Tech Influencers and Innovators
Social media platforms like Twitter and LinkedIn are great for following thought leaders in computer engineering. Influencers often share opinions, news, and resources that are valuable for staying current.

Browsing HyperCard stacks on our RP2350-based Fruit Jam 🍏📂
With a little more tweaking, we've got a nice big 12MB disk image loading into our Pico-Mac port https://github.com/jepler/pico-mac/tree/rp2350-fruitjam to the Fruit Jam https://www.adafruit.com/product/6200 — that 16MB of internal flash is coming in super useful now!
That means not only can we run System 6 but also install some nice software like HyperCard https://en.wikipedia.org/wiki/HyperCard !
As kids, we loved playing and making HyperCard stacks, so it's neat to see that we can still navigate the classics on an RP2350. Many stacks have music or sound effects, so we'll revisit these once we get audio playback working.

Desk of Ladyada - I2S DACs, Claude API, and Compute Module Backpack 🤖🎒🥧 https://youtu.be/XihMNhTyUlg
Ladyada explores I2S DACs, testing PCM51xx as a UDA1334A alternative. Work continues on the TLV320DAC3100, we test an AI API interface for setters/getters for Claude with pay per token. A new Pi Compute Module backpack is in progress - And we search for tall connectors for CM4/CM5.
